Quick Peanut Butter Beef and Shishito Pepper Stir Fry

Mark this as another way to enjoy ground beef. I can’t get over how tasty it is – I mean, melted peanut butter and sweet chili sauce. 

Start by charring the peppers in a hot and dry pan – they cook in less than 5 minutes. The beef crisps up nicely and then you add the remaining ingredients.

While they are usually used in appetizer recipes, shishito peppers are mild, cook up so quickly – that adding them into your main entrée is quick and easy. They add a great flavor to the stir fry.

Quick Peanut Butter Beef and Shishito Pepper Stir Fry

  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: 4-6 1x
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Description

A new and simple way to combine shishito peppers that cook in 5 minutes with tender ground beef pieces!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 6 oz. shishito peppers
  • 1 lb. ground beef
  • 1 heaping tablespoon tapioca fl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on each salt and p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ili flakes
  • 2 heaping tablespoons high quality peanut butter
  • 1/4 cup roasted and salted peanuts
  • 1/3 cup sweet chili sauce
  • 1 scallion, chopped

Instructions

  1. Heat up a heavy duty skillet over high heat. When the pan is very hot, toss in the shishito peppers. Let them sit for 4 minutes before turning over or mixing around.
  2. Meanwhile, combine the ground beef with the tapioca flour, salt and pepper. Toss with your hands or wooden spoon to combine. Let sit.
  3. Toss the shishito peppers around after the first side is toasted brown. Cook for an additional 1-2 minutes. Remove the peppers from the skillet to your serving plate or platter.
  4. Add the ground beef to the hot pan. Spread out quickly into a large burger size patty. Cook for 6 minutes.
  5. Carefully flip the patty over. Using a spatula or wooden spoon, break the patty up into large 2 inch pieces, while continuing to cook the meat. Cook until it is fully cooked. Turn the heat off.
  6. Drain off any fat from the pan.
  7. Add in the chili flakes, peanut butter, peanuts, sweet chili sauce, scallions and shishito peppers to the pan. Toss around to coat everything with the sauce. Serve immediately.
